Newfoundland 5 Cents 1946C

1946

A 1946.800 silver 5 cents weighing 0.0379 oz (1.18g), 15.49 mm diameter. Reverse: The reverse features the Newfoundland pitcher plant (Sarracenia purpurea), the provincial floral emblem; the 1946C 5-cent is extremely rare with a mintage of only 2,041 pieces. Mintage: 2,041. Contains approximately 0.030 oz of silver (melt value applies).
